“The man who once took a bullet for me stood in our living room, demanding I apologize to his pregnant mistress. He was the broke kid I'd made into a CEO, the foundation of my world. Now, that foundation was a sinkhole. But the real betrayal came from his mistress's lips. She whispered that Jacob had orchestrated the car accident that caused my miscarriage years ago, claiming he never wanted a child with a "cold, barren bitch" like me. He tried to move her into my house, painting me as the villain in our story. He paraded their love for the world to see, buying her islands and diamonds while I was cast aside as the city's ice queen. The love I had for him, built on what I thought was shared grief over our lost son, turned to ash. It was all a lie. Ten years of my life, a carefully staged play he directed. But he forgot who I am. At a grand gala meant to celebrate his new life, I crashed the party. With the evidence in hand and my allies at my side, I was ready to burn his empire to the ground and make him pay for every single lie.”
